Chiguirip District
District in Cajamarca, Peru
Chiguirip | |
---|---|
District | |
Country | Peru |
Region | Cajamarca |
Province | Chota |
Founded | October 31, 1896 |
Capital | Chiguirip |
Government | |
• Mayor | Joel Ysaias Quispe Nuñez |
Area | |
• Total | 51.44 km2 (19.86 sq mi) |
Elevation | 2,650 m (8,690 ft) |
Population (2005 census) | |
• Total | 5,106 |
• Density | 99/km2 (260/sq mi) |
Time zone | UTC-5 (PET) |
UBIGEO | 060404 |
Chiguirip District is one of nineteen districts of the province Chota in Peru.[1]
